概括
使用人工智能和生物信息学的败血症分类提供了个性化的治疗. 本综述探讨了诸如生命体征,生物标志物和分子数据等方法,以改善患者的预后并指导器官保护策略.
科学领域:
- 综合生物信息学和人工智能应用于重症监护医学.
背景情况:
- 败血症是一种危及生命的疾病,患者表现不同,需要精确的分类才能有效治疗.
- 败血症临床表现,治疗反应和预后的异质性强调了需要先进的分类方法.
研究的目的:
- 系统地审查当前的败血症分类方法,整合人工智能和生物信息学.
- 评估针对个性化医学的各种败血症类型化策略的临床应用价值.
主要方法:
- 基于临床数据 (例如,生命体征,体温轨迹) 的败血症分类的审查.
- 对生物标志物和免疫指数分类的分析,以反映病理生理状态并指导免疫治疗.
- 整合分子数据 (转录组,基因定型) 以揭示败血症异质性.
- 在败血症中对器官功能障碍 (ARDS,AKI,肝损伤) 的系统审查.
主要成果:
- 临床数据,生物标志物和分子概况为败血症亚型和患者预后提供了独特的见解.
- 温度轨迹和免疫指数有助于预测结果和确定针对性治疗的患者群体.
- 分子数据为治疗败血症的精准医学提供了基础,解决异质性问题.
- 了解器官损伤模式可以为目标器官保护策略提供信息.
结论:
- 人工智能和生物信息学驱动的败血症分类方法显示出临床应用和个性化治疗的前景.
- 目前的方法在类型稳定性和生物标志物选择方面面临挑战,需要进一步研究.
- 未来的努力应专注于开发可靠的工具,以精确管理败血症并改善患者的治疗结果.

The meaning of illness is individualized to each person who experiences an alteration in health. In contrast, disease is a medical term indicating a pathological change in the structure and function of the body or mind. It is a condition that has specific symptoms and boundaries.
An illness is a response to a disease in which the person's level of functioning is changed compared with a previous level. The general classification of illness includes acute and chronic.
